Marblehead's 'Charming Market' Named One of Boston's Best
A Marblehead market has been named best gourmet market in the latest round of "Best of Boston" awards.
A Marblehead market in Village Plaza has been named one of the “Best of Boston” for 2014 by Boston magazine.
Becky’s Gourmet sells fresh produce, baked goods, flowers and cheeses and also offers sandwiches and prepared dishes.
The magazine named it the best gourmet market in the suburbs north of Boston, calling it a “charming market” with “a veritable cornucopia of gloriously fresh produce, organic specialty items and mouthwatering prepared foods.”

The awards are in the magazine’s August “Best of Boston” issue. It was the only Marblehead business that was named as part of the 41st annual list and one of only a handful of winners on the North Shore.
